Transaction af6fa151085940056de1ddb8ae1ea630fa7bdfd864da33c080fdb28c5120812c

4 Input
2 Outputs
  • af6fa151085940056de1ddb8ae1ea630fa7bdfd864da33c080fdb28c5120812c:0
  • value  1002221
    address  3KbLJ1SL5W7DZ5TTA7ijYV7TCZTLsB8ZuQ
  • af6fa151085940056de1ddb8ae1ea630fa7bdfd864da33c080fdb28c5120812c:1
  • value  24275717
    address  16PxCDuJxuWxMYNtKCRgzeNFEg3nr23skZ